How much money have you spent on Dota 2?
(Incase you don't know how to check the amount of money you've spent):

1. Navigate to your Steam profile
2. Locate "Badges" and press it
3. Find Dota 2 in the list and press "How do i earn card drops?" which is beside Either "[quantity] card drops remaining" or "No card drops remaining"
4. The amount of money you've spent is shown above the progression bar to the next card drop
